Bonus Mathematics

Understanding the real value of a casino bonus prevents nasty surprises. Let’s walk through a typical welcome offer: a 100% deposit match up to €100 plus 50 free spins on a popular slot. The wagering requirement is often stated as “35x (deposit + bonus)”. Here is how to calculate the total playthrough.

  • Deposit: €100
  • Bonus: €100 (100% match)
  • Total balance to wager: €100 + €100 = €200
  • Wagering multiplier: 35x
  • Total wagering requirement: €200 × 35 = €7,000

Now assume the slot has an RTP (return to player) of 96%. The expected loss while wagering €7,000 is:

Expected loss = Total wagering × (1 – RTP) = €7,000 × 0.04 = €280

The bonus itself is €100, but the expected loss from the wagering is €280. So the net expected value (EV) of the bonus is negative: €100 – €280 = –€180. That does not mean you will lose that amount – it is an average over many players. Variance can work in your favour, but the house edge remains. A better approach is to use the free spins first (which often have lower or no wagering) and treat the deposit bonus as a chance to play, not a guaranteed profit. Always check game contribution percentages; slots usually cont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10% or 20%.

Troubleshooting

  • Login fails after password reset: Clear your browser cache and cookies, then try logging in again using the “Incognito” or “Private” mode. If the issue persists, check if your account has been locked due to multiple failed attempts – contact support to unlock it.
  • Withdrawal shows as “Pending” for more than 48 hours: First, ensure all required documents have been uploaded and approved. If they are, contact live chat or email support with your player ID and ask for an update. Casinos may delay payments for manual checks, but anything over 72 hours without communication is unusual.
  • Bonus was not credited after deposit: Reload the cashier page or go to the “My Bonuses” section. If it still doesn’t appear, type “Missing bonus” in the live chat – support can often trigger it manually. Never start playing before the bonus is active, or you may forfeit it.
  • Game freezes or doesn’t load: Switch from Wi‑Fi to mobile data (or vice versa) to rule out a local network issue. If using the PWA from the browser, close and reopen it. Also try a different browser (Chrome, Firefox, Edge). If the problem continues, it may be a server‑side issue – check the casino’s social channels for maintenance updates.
  • Verification document rejected: The most common reasons are blurry images, expired ID, or mismatched name. Re‑upload a clear photo of the front and back of the document. Ensure the name and address exactly match what you entered during registration. If the rejection reason isn’t clear, ask support for specifics – they can usually tell you exactly what is missing.
  • 2FA code not working: Verify that the time on your authenticator app is synchronised with your device (automatic sync). If you just switched phones, you may need to re‑scan the QR code from the casino’s security settings. Request a backup code or contact support to disable and re‑enable 2FA.

Insider Advice – How to Handle a Delayed Withdrawal

If your withdrawal request exceeds the stated processing time, follow this proactive approach:

  1. Wait the full pending period (usually 24–72 hours). Do not cancel and re‑submit, as that resets the queue.
  2. Reach out via live chat – this is the fastest channel. Provide your player ID and the withdrawal reference number. Ask for a specific reason for the delay.
  3. If live chat is unavailable or unhelpful, send an email to the support address (check the “Contact Us” page). Include a screenshot of the withdrawal status.
  4. Escalate to a manager if you receive only generic replies after 24 hours. Use the same email thread and request a ticket to be created for your complaint.
  5. After 5 business days with no resolution, file a complaint with the licensing authority (e.g., Curacao eGaming) or use a third‑party mediator like the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) body listed on the site. Many casinos respond faster when an external entity is involved.

What is the difference between wagering on slots vs table games?

Slots typically count 100% toward wagering, while table games (blackjack, roulette, baccarat) usually count only 5–20% or are excluded entirely. Always read the bonus terms to know which games give the best wagering progress.

Can I withdraw my bonus money immediately?

No, bonus money is not withdrawable until the wagering requirement is met. If you try to withdraw before finishing wagering, you will forfeit the bonus and any winnings earned with it.
